Retail ERP Licensing Cost Comparison: Odoo vs SAP vs Oracle vs NetSuite
Retail ERP selection is rarely decided by license price alone. For retail organizations, the real cost picture includes subscription or perpetual licensing, implementation services, integration work, data migration, support, upgrades, and the operational impact of customization choices. Odoo, SAP, Oracle, and NetSuite approach licensing very differently, which makes direct comparison difficult unless buyers normalize the commercial model and the expected deployment scope.
This comparison focuses on retail buyer concerns: how each vendor prices software, what drives total cost of ownership, where implementation complexity increases budget risk, and which platform profiles fit different retail operating models. The goal is not to identify a universal winner, but to help finance, IT, and operations leaders understand where each ERP can be cost-efficient and where hidden expense often appears.
How retail ERP licensing cost should be evaluated
Retail ERP pricing is often misunderstood because vendors package functionality in different ways. Some emphasize named users, some bundle modules, some price by revenue or transaction scale, and some separate core ERP from retail-specific capabilities such as POS, merchandising, warehouse management, planning, and eCommerce connectors. A lower entry price can still result in a higher long-term cost if the retailer needs extensive partner development, third-party add-ons, or frequent process redesign.
- License or subscription structure: user-based, module-based, enterprise agreement, or consumption-oriented pricing
- Implementation services: solution design, configuration, testing, training, and change management
- Retail-specific scope: POS, omnichannel inventory, promotions, replenishment, store operations, and returns
- Integration costs: eCommerce, payment gateways, marketplaces, CRM, WMS, tax engines, and BI platforms
- Customization burden: code-level changes, extension frameworks, and upgrade impact
- Migration effort: product data, customer records, suppliers, pricing rules, inventory, and historical transactions
- Ongoing support and optimization: internal admin effort, partner dependency, and release management

Implementation complexity and budget risk
Implementation complexity is one of the biggest drivers of ERP cost variance in retail. A platform with lower licensing can still become expensive if the retailer needs extensive process redesign, custom integrations, or data cleansing. Conversely, a higher-cost ERP may reduce project risk if it already supports the retailer's target operating model.
Odoo implementation profile
Odoo implementations are often faster for small and mid-sized retail organizations with relatively standard finance, inventory, purchasing, and eCommerce requirements. Its modular architecture supports phased deployment, which can reduce upfront cost. The main risk appears when retailers try to replicate highly specific workflows through custom development rather than process standardization. In those cases, partner quality becomes a major cost variable.
SAP implementation profile
SAP is typically the most implementation-intensive option in this comparison. It is often selected by large retailers with complex supply chains, international operations, and strict governance requirements. The platform can support broad transformation, but project budgets often expand due to process harmonization, data governance, integration architecture, and organizational change management. SAP can be commercially justified when the retailer's complexity is already high enough to require enterprise-grade controls.
Oracle implementation profile
Oracle implementations vary depending on whether the retailer is adopting a focused ERP footprint or a broader Oracle application and infrastructure strategy. Oracle can be strong in organizations that already use Oracle databases, analytics, or supply chain tools. Cost risk usually comes from portfolio breadth: multiple products, multiple implementation workstreams, and the need to align enterprise architecture decisions with business process goals.
NetSuite implementation profile
NetSuite generally offers a more contained implementation path than SAP or Oracle for midmarket and upper-midmarket retailers. It is often easier to deploy in organizations seeking standardized cloud ERP with multi-entity finance, inventory, and omnichannel visibility. Complexity rises when retailers require advanced warehouse operations, highly specialized merchandising logic, or extensive third-party retail ecosystem integration.

Customization analysis and upgrade implications
Customization is often where ERP licensing savings are either preserved or lost. Retailers should distinguish between configuration, extension, and core code modification. The more deeply the system is altered, the more expensive upgrades, testing, and support become.
- Odoo offers significant flexibility and can be adapted quickly, but heavy customization can create partner dependency and upgrade friction.
- SAP supports extensive enterprise tailoring, yet customization programs can become expensive and require strict governance to avoid long-term complexity.
- Oracle provides robust extension options, but customization decisions should be aligned carefully with Oracle's broader application roadmap.
- NetSuite generally encourages structured customization within its cloud model, which can improve upgrade predictability compared with heavily modified on-premise environments.
From a cost perspective, retailers should favor process standardization where possible and reserve customization for true competitive differentiation, regulatory requirements, or unavoidable operational constraints.

Migration considerations
Migration cost is often underestimated in retail ERP business cases. Product masters, pricing rules, promotions, supplier records, customer data, inventory balances, open orders, and historical financials all require cleansing and mapping. The more fragmented the legacy environment, the more expensive migration becomes.
- Odoo migrations are often manageable for smaller environments, but data quality issues can still create significant project delays.
- SAP migrations usually require the most formal data governance and process harmonization effort, especially in multinational retail groups.
- Oracle migrations can be efficient when the retailer already uses Oracle technologies, but broader transformation programs increase complexity.
- NetSuite migrations are often more structured for cloud adoption, though legacy retail customizations may still require substantial redesign.
Retailers should budget separately for data cleansing, test cycles, cutover planning, and post-go-live stabilization. These costs are often not visible in initial software discussions but can materially change the business case.
